New York Governor Issues Emergency Proclamation, Letting Voters Registered in Nine Particular Counties Vote in Any Precinct

Posted on November 5, 2012 by adminNovember 5, 2012
6

Here is a copy of an executive order issued by New York Governor Andrew Cuomo. It allows residents of New York city, and four particular nearby suburban counties, to vote in any precinct. However, the voter will be better off … Continue reading →

Billings Gazette Covers the Fact that Almost 2/3rds of Wyoming Legislative Elections Have Only One Candidate

Posted on November 5, 2012 by adminNovember 5, 2012
7

The Billings Gazette has this story, that almost 2/3rds of Wyoming state legislative races have only one person running. Thanks to Mike Fellows for the link. Ironically, the Billings Gazette is a Montana newspaper, not a Wyoming newspaper. … Continue reading →
